      Hi Ian thanks for your comments.
      I had a problem, I bought a new case for my filters the other week, Then left the darn thing at home. So I had to use f16 -f22 to blur the water. Its only my second time out with the 11-22 and I think after f11 diffraction takes hold.
      I hope to try again sometime soon.
